Day 16: The transformation begins – Complete deck and cockpit sanding

May 29, 2025 · 15 min · 591 views

What this video covers

Jorman continues a boat restoration project on day 16, focusing on sanding the deck and cockpit of a sailboat currently in a boatyard.Watch The vessel’s deck features multiple layers of degraded paint that require extensive removal.1:37 Jorman uses a Makita power sander for large, accessible surfaces and performs manual sanding in tight corners and irregular areas where the machine cannot reach.3:02 He also sands previously filled holes and repairs made to the cockpit and wooden doors, achieving a smooth finish on those sections.11:46 Despite setting a goal to complete the entire sanding process in five hours, he finishes approximately 50% of the work, leaving the remainder for the following day.10:43 He emphasizes the importance of using protective gear, specifically a high-quality respirator, to manage dust exposure during the intensive sanding process.6:04
